What Is a Notary Public?

A notary public is an official authorized by the state to perform specific legal duties. These duties typically include witnessing signatures, verifying identities, and certifying documents. Notaries act as impartial witnesses in transactions involving important paperwork, ensuring that all parties involved understand the contents and implications of the documents.

Notaries serve various functions, including those related to real estate transactions, wills, and contracts. They prevent fraud by confirming the identities of individuals signing documents. Each state has its own rules governing notaries, including the requirements for becoming a notary and the scope of their authority.

Common Misconceptions About Notary Services

Several misconceptions hinder understanding of notary services. Many believe all notaries can perform the same functions; however, only certified notaries meet specific state requirements. Another common misunderstanding involves the necessity of notarization. Some people think notarization is optional, not recognizing that specific documents, like wills and real estate deeds, often need it to be legally binding. Additionally, some assume that notarization guarantees a document’s legality. In reality, notarization only verifies identities and witness signatures; it does not ensure the content is lawful.
